Connecting the d evice
Please observe the safety information in "Important notes", Page 3.
CE conformance and optimum picture quality are guaranteed only if
you use the data cables supplied.
► Switch off the monitor and the computer.
► Disconnect the power plug from the computer.
Connecting cables to the mon
itor
The data cable supplied has two 15-pin D-SUB connectors for connection
to the monitor and to the computer.
Information on the computer connections and interfaces can be found in the
operating manual for the computer.

1 = Security slot for the "Kensington Lock"
2 = Power connection socket
3 = D-SUB conne ction socket (analogue)
4 = A UDIO IN socket
5 = Holes for securing the sw ivel arm or wall
mounting
► Select the d ata cable that is appropriate for your computer.
► Connect one of the data cable connectors to the D-SUB connector on the monitor and
secure the plug-in connection by tightening the safety screws.
► Insert one plug on the audio cable into the AUDIO IN socket on the monitor,
making sure it is prop erly engaged.
► Plug the supplied power cable into the po wer connector on t he monitor.
A lock (Kensington Lock) can be fitted in the security slot to protect the monitor
against theft. A Kensington Lock is not included w ith the monitor at delivery.
